Updates won't be quick fix for Mercedes – Wolff
May 6 Toto Wolff has admitted Mercedes is not an update or two away from returning to the top step of the podium in Formula 1. After winning every single constructors' championship of the previous regulations era, the German giant has stumbled badly as Ferrari and Red Bull run away with early dominance in 2022. For Mercedes, it's a fundamental reset – but team boss Wolff insists it will not affect his focus on F1. 'No!' he told Osterreich newspaper. 'You can't win ten years in a row without falling flat on your face sometimes. 'Now we're trying to recover, which gives us the chance to restructure the team.'
